React set object in state

WebFeb 7, 2024 · In React, useState can store any type of value, whereas the state in a class component is limited to being an object. This includes primitive data types like string, number, and Boolean, as well as complex … WebI personally rely on this deep copy strategy. JSON.parse(JSON.stringify(object)) rather than spread operator because it got me into weird bugs while dealing with nested objects or multi dimensional arrays. spread operator does not do a deep copy if I am correct and will lead to state mutations with NESTED objects in React.. Please run through the code to get a …

Handling Objects in React Component State Ship Shape

WebDec 28, 2024 · Creating React Application: Step 1: Create a React application using the following command: npx create-react-app foldername Step 2: After creating your project folder i.e. foldername, move to it using the following command: cd foldername Project Structure: It will look like the following. Project Structure App.js Javascript WebApr 10, 2024 · How to Insert API Data Object’s Values into Array State in React Step 1: Install React Project Step 2: Install Required Dependencies Step 3: Create Functional Component Step 4: Add API Data in Array State Step 5: Register Component in App.JS Step 6: Run React Server Install React Project curl token bearer https://quinessa.com

How to Push API Data or Values into a State Array in React

WebJan 17, 2024 · Another option which works well for me is to create a copy of the state object using Object.assign (), then adjust properties through dot notation and then set the created copy to the state: let newState = Object.assign ( {}, this.state); newState.recipes [1].title = "Tofu Stir Fry and other stuff"; this.setState (newState); 3 Likes WebInside the component, in the constructor, an initial state is defined with which the component will be initialized after rendering. The only requirement React has for the state … WebApr 10, 2024 · The setState () method enqueues all of the updates made to the component state and instructs React to re-render the component and its children with the updated state. Always use the setState () method to change the state object, since it will ensure that the component knows it’s been updated and calls the render () method. curl token访问

ReactJS setState() - GeeksforGeeks

Category:javascript - React Hooks useState() with Object - Stack …

Tags:React set object in state

React set object in state

Midhisha Bhimireddy - California State University - LinkedIn

WebMar 31, 2024 · React components can possess internal “state,” a set of key-value pairs which belong to the component. When the state changes, React re-renders the … WebTo change a value in the state object, use the this.setState () method. When a value in the state object changes, the component will re-render, meaning that the output will change …

React set object in state

Did you know?

WebMay 18, 2024 · Given objects are exhaustive only by hardware limitations, you can make them as complex as you wish. If a component calls the toggle () function from a context, it will trigger a state change...

WebFeb 24, 2024 · React provides a variety of special functions that allow us to provide new capabilities to components, like state. These functions are called hooks, and the useState hook, as its name implies, is precisely the one we need in order to give our component some state. To use a React hook, we need to import it from the React module. WebMar 3, 2024 · To manage the state, React provides a special method called setState (). You use it like this: class User { ... increaseScore () { this.setState ( { score: this.state.score + 1 }); } ... } Note how setState () works. You …

WebMar 10, 2024 · React provides a method called setState for this purpose. setState () enqueues changes to the component state and tells React that this component and its children need to be re-rendered with the updated state. this.setState ( {quantity: 2}) Here, we passed setState () an object containing part (s) of the state we wanted to update. Web[英]React setState : unable to update state object 2024-01-20 19:38:06 2 34 javascript / reactjs. setState 動態多維 object [英]setState of dynamic multidimensional object ... [英]SetState and push object in array in nested dynamic array of objects in React JS

WebApr 11, 2024 · STATE. In React, a State is an object that holds the data and behavior of a component. It represents the current state of the component and can be updated over …

WebFeb 16, 2024 · To set the initial state, use this.state in the constructor with your ES6 class React.Component syntax. Don’t forget to invoke super () with properties, otherwise the logic in parent (... curl to node fetchWeb2 hours ago · NEW! Noting that a tentative agreement still needs to be finalized, leaders of Rutgers faculty unions spoke enthusiastically early Saturday morning of the framework of … curl tool for api testingWeb23 hours ago · After some hours struggling I tried to initialize the state to an array. const [users, setUsers] = useState([]) And lo and behold, it works! The real problem is that I don't know why. Why is the initial type of the state so important? Why setState can't change it? curl too many requestsWebJun 13, 2024 · When you update state by passing an object inside setState (), the state is updated by shallow merging. Shallow merging is a concept in javascript,using which if two objects are merged, the properties with same keys are overwritten by value of the same keys of second object. curl tool onlineWebOct 6, 2024 · setState is the API method provided with the library so that the user is able to define and manipulate state over time. Three Rules of Thumb When Using setState ( ) Do … curl toolWeb2 hours ago · NEW! Noting that a tentative agreement still needs to be finalized, leaders of Rutgers faculty unions spoke enthusiastically early Saturday morning of the framework of a contract that could end ... curl to output it to your terminal anywayWebJan 13, 2024 · Step 1: Create a React application using the following command: npx create-react-app foldername Step 2: After creating your project folder i.e. foldername, move to it … curl tool for jira cloud